Functional analysis of a carboxylesterase gene involved in beta-cypermethrin and phoxim resistance in Plutella xylostella (L.)

Ran Li et al.

Summary: The study demonstrated that overexpression of the Px alpha E8 gene is associated with resistance to multiple insecticides in Plutella xylostella, leading to increased CarE activity and Px alpha E8 expression when exposed to insecticides. Knockdown of Px alpha E8 expression resulted in increased insecticide resistance, while transgenic Drosophila overexpressing Px alpha E8 showed higher tolerance to insecticides.

Characterization and functional analysis of two acetylcholinesterase genes in Bradysia odoriphaga Yang et Zhang (Diptera: Sciaridae)

Qian Ding et al.

Summary: Two acetylcholinesterase genes (Boace1 and Boace2) have been identified in the devastating soil pest Bradysia odoriphaga, with distinct expression patterns across developmental stages and tissues. Silencing of these genes significantly affects susceptibility to insecticides and mortality rates. Boace1 may play a major neurobiological role and serve as a primary target for insecticides.

Identification of key residues of carboxylesterase PxEst-6 involved in pyrethroid metabolism in Plutella xylostella (L.)

Yifan Li et al.

Summary: Long-term and excessive use of insecticides has led to severe environmental problems and insecticide resistance in insects. This study investigated the detoxification process of Plutella xylostella carboxylesterase 6 and identified key residues and sites crucial for metabolizing pyrethroid insecticides, providing insights into pyrethroid resistance in P. xylostella.
